Resin Tips: Micas & Neons
I love playing with resin, mica powders and “neon” or blacklight powders. What surprised me while experimenting with both pigments is just how well they work together. There is some impact on both sides. The neons may slightly dull the brightness of the micas, and the micas may dull the Read more…

Resin Reviews: New Classic Epoxy Resin & Liquid Diamonds Epoxy Resin
New Classic Resin My latest resin experiments feature New Classic Epoxy Resin. A 1:1 thick and hard-drying resin that is scent-free and crystal-clear, New Classic was delivered quickly, without any problems. New Classic Resin works great, dries hard and clear, with no stickiness. There tend to be a lot of Read more…
